How Hard Is It To Get Into Brevard College?

Brevard College admits 42%, which makes it moderately selective. Ensure you meet all application requirements and prepare the application in full.

Of those admitted, 27% choose to enroll — a typical enrollment-to-admission yield.

Average Test Scores

14% of admitted students submitted SAT scores and 28% submitted ACT scores.

When looking at the 25th through the 75th percentile of admitted students at Brevard College, SAT Evidence-Based Reading and Writing scores ranged between 440 and 620. Math scores were between 430 and 600.

Combined SAT scores ranged from 870 to 1220.

ACT Composite scores for admitted students at Brevard College ranged between 16 and 26.

Can I Afford Brevard College?

The average net price after aid at Brevard College is $21,376.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group.
